Output 8b569ef2ac239637b8be45cfac02935a7fd102d0f04af16aff8c514e4e900fa4:0

value
2508580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ddaecad451a14a710f1157dfbb967894ce23b814 OP_EQUAL
address
3MuAeijW9PtMzRTE3JG6djeUN8dnoSnWNT
transaction
8b569ef2ac239637b8be45cfac02935a7fd102d0f04af16aff8c514e4e900fa4
spent
true